Transaction 62a24dfbe4012c6af1c574bbde9e897c1e5e9a9e32aab62acc9c5f9df8a0f119
1 Input
1 Output
-
62a24dfbe4012c6af1c574bbde9e897c1e5e9a9e32aab62acc9c5f9df8a0f119:0
- value
- 17977
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d79dc656a80c946f5d5fb5b585c7e66053a7edb
- address
- bc1qp4uacet2sry5daw4ldd4shr7vczn5lkmaa3wjp